Chapter 167 Deceiving Meereen

Lei Bao, who was receiving prisoners, suddenly heard West shouting.

"I am the leader of the Golden Company, and I want to buy my freedom!"

"Quiet down, what are you shouting for! Can't you see I'm busy here? Hey you, gag him."

Annoyed by the noise, Lei Bao had his mouth gagged to stop him from shouting.

After taking stock, it was found that the Golden Regiment had lost 40% of its men in the previous battle, leaving only 2,000 out of 5,000, and more than 600 of them were wounded.

"Take them all back and keep a close watch on them. Don't let them escape. We'll deal with them after we take Meereen City."

West, who was in the crowd, almost burst into tears when he heard Lei Bao's words.

It's over! The Golden Company's reputation is completely ruined.

West, who became the leader of the Golden Company, was no fool. He knew that the enemy's ambush here was not for a simple purpose; they wanted to impersonate the Golden Company and seize the city directly.

If they weren't going to seize the city, why would they only send a small team of a hundred men to take them away?

On his way away, West turned his head and saw that, sure enough, the other side had started to change into the Golden Company's armor and even put on their banner.

"Waaaaah~ Waaaah~"

With a rag stuffed in his mouth, the squad members who led them away couldn't hear what West was saying at all, and could only warn him to behave.

What West really wanted to say was, "I'll take you there. I know the way, and I can even help you trick your way through the city gates."

Since the Golden Company was destroyed anyway, West wanted to find a way out for himself. Before coming, he had inquired and learned that the emerging power of Dragon City was very strong and had only taken one day to break through Abyss City.

If Meereen hadn't asked for such a high price, I wouldn't have taken such a big risk to bring the Golden Company to help Meereen.

I've lost out! I've suffered a huge loss this time!

West, who kept looking back, was eventually taken away by the hundred-man squad.

After changing his clothes, Lei Bao led his light cavalry to Hao Yun.

"Lord of the city, we are ready and can set off to seize the city at any time."

"What are you going to do with the elephant cavalry?"

"Let's set off together. I just interrogated a Golden Company elephant cavalryman and obtained a simple method for controlling them."

Of the five hundred white elephants, four hundred and ninety-four remained after the chaos. Six of them had injured their legs and were unable to move because they had run around.

"Okay, then I'll leave it to you. Set off under the moonlight, and remember to send a signal once you arrive in Meereen."

The troops set off again, with Lei Bao leading five thousand light cavalrymen in new uniforms, heading towards Meereen City.

As for the nobleman who led the way in Meereen, he died in the chaos of battle. Once we arrive in Meereen, Lei Bao will have to act according to the situation.

However, Lei Bao was clearly overthinking things. When he arrived in Meereen, the soldiers guarding the city gate only asked him a few simple questions: Who are you? Where are you from? What are you doing in Meereen?

Upon learning that it was the Golden Legion, the gate guards immediately sent someone to inform the nobles in the city and opened the city gates to let them pass.

Lei Bao never expected that it would be so easy to trick his way into opening the city gate; he easily slipped into the city.

"Send a signal."

Lei Bao gripped the hilt of his sword and slashed the approaching gatekeeper to death.

"Move! Seize the city gates immediately!"

At a command, a small squad of five thousand light cavalrymen climbed the city wall and took control of it, while the rest guarded the street entrances, killing one by one, or two by two.

Hao Yun, who was hanging far behind, saw the red signal flare in the sky above Milin City and shouted loudly without saying a word.

"Attack! Charge!"

Hao Yun took the lead, riding Moonlight and leaving the heavy cavalry behind, arriving at the city gate of Meereen first.

At this moment, shouts of battle erupted at the city gate. The slave owners, who had just learned of the Golden Legion's arrival and had come to greet them, were terrified by the other side's actions and didn't know what to do.

Upon receiving the same notification, Sai Li rushed over and, seeing that the city gates had fallen, loudly berated these fools.

"What are you all looking at? Hurry up and concentrate your troops to send over here! If we wait for enemy reinforcements to arrive, Meereen will be completely lost!"

The slave owners then came to their senses and frantically ordered their servants to inform the soldiers to come to the north gate to defend against the enemy.

"Awoo~"

As Moonlight charged through the city gate, it let out a wolf howl, and the five wolf cubs following behind quickly joined the battle.

In five months, the five wolf cubs that followed Hao Yun grew into giant wolves with a body length of two meters, but they were still much smaller than Moonlight.

However, they still hold an absolute advantage when facing ordinary people.

After the five wolf cubs joined the battle, they quickly charged into the enemy camp, causing a bloodbath behind enemy lines. Even when surrounded, they didn't care.

Because spears and swords are like tickling them.

Moonlight, which hadn't participated in a battle for a long time, was also getting restless at this moment. If Hao Yun hadn't been on its body, it probably would have rushed up long ago.

Hao Yun, sensing Moonlight's thoughts, jumped down and stroked the soft fur on Moonlight's neck.

"Go if you want to."

Moonlight nuzzled Hao Yun with its head, then leaped into the battlefield. Its killing speed was far faster than that of the five wolf cubs.

The five wolf cubs were just growing fast; they had never actually experienced real killing before. When they rushed into the battlefield, they relied entirely on their superior physical abilities to fight.

With Moonlight's instruction, the five little wolves quickly adapted to the killing. The six ice wolves were like killing machines on the battlefield, killing their opponents in just a few minutes.

Rumble!

The heavy cavalry finally arrived and charged into the city gate, where Lei Bao and his light cavalry quickly made way.

"kill!"

The heavy cavalry, aided by their powerful horses, launched a small charge that instantly shattered the enemy's defenses.

Many of the slave owners watching from the distant high-rise buildings collapsed to the ground in terror.

"It's over! We've lost."

Those who managed to remain calm were already preparing to go home, pack their belongings, and flee.

Seri sat among them, observing the disgraceful behavior of those around him, without a trace of panic in his eyes. He simply sat down quietly and drank.

He had long known that Milin would be defeated by Longcheng, but he hadn't expected it to be so quick, just like his own defeat, where he was utterly powerless to fight back.

He ignored the people around him as they dispersed and sat alone in the building drinking. Even when his family members called him to leave, he did not go.

The chaos lasted all night, and at noon the next day, Wang Shouren arrived with the Immaculate Ones and 10,000 reserve troops.

In the heart of the city, in a towering palace that seemed to reach into the clouds, Hao Yun sat on a chair made of gold and jewels, looking down at the crowd below.

No wonder everyone wants to be emperor, it feels different. It's just that the chair is a bit cold and not very comfortable to sit on.

"Lord City Lord, according to our investigation, there were 182 robberies, 678 heinous murders, and the rape of 10 women last night..."

The one who spoke was Bell, who had come with the army of the Unsullied. Hao Yun waved his hand to interrupt him before he could finish speaking.

"No need to say more, as is customary, drag all these people to the city center and behead them."

Bell originally disagreed with Hao Yun's indiscriminate killing after seizing the city, but what he saw today changed his mind; these people truly deserved to die.

Chapter 168 Son of the Harpy

The city of Meereen is much larger than the Abyss and Dragon City, and its population is also greater than that of both cities.

The population of Meereen was over five million, but nearly four million of them were slaves.

Hao Yun was very surprised by this. How could these slave owners enjoy their four million slaves so peacefully? Weren't they afraid that the slaves would rebel?

As it turned out, they weren't afraid at all; slave riots were a very common occurrence.

The human-shaped signposts placed on both sides of the road to Meereen are the work of slave owners.

They turned young slaves into living signs, firstly to warn the slaves that their lives were in their hands, and secondly to warn outsiders that Meereen was powerful.

However, all of this has now been shattered by Hao Yun.

Inside the palace, Hao Yun, who had nothing to do, began to bathe the ice wolves. The battle the previous night had left their fur stained with a lot of blood.

Giving them a bath is a huge undertaking. First, Hao Yun needs to use magic to create a large pool of clean water.

Wrap the direwolves in clean water to remove the initial dirt from their bodies.

Discard the dirty water and continue with the previous step: apply shampoo and rub it all over your body.

After washing, use fire magic to dry them.

Hao Yun spent three hours trying to deal with the six dire wolves, but he couldn't manage it. So far, he's only managed to clean Moonlight, Little Three, and Little Four.

After waiting for a long time, Xiao Wu and Xiao Liu came close to Hao Yun, their tails wagging like windmills.

"Don't rush, it'll be your turn soon."

Just as Hao Yun was about to give Xiao Wu a bath, Bell rushed in.

Turning his head to look at Bell, Hao Yun asked with a smile.

"Panting heavily, chased by a dog!"

"Lord City, it's terrible! There's trouble in the city!"

After listening to Bell's words, Hao Yun patted Xiao Wu's head and closed his eyes to probe with his divine sense.

In the city center, the Unsullied, who were executing criminals, were surrounded by layers of slaves. If the Unsullied hadn't been armed and in an attack stance, the slaves would probably have already charged at them.

After observation, Hao Yun found the cause of the conflict: the killing of slaves who had caused trouble the previous night had sparked the riot.

Most of the gathered slaves were unaware of what those who had been executed had done the previous night, and the Unsullied did not explain it to them.

"Moonlight, come with me. Bell, you wait here for me."

He flipped himself onto the moonlight and rode out of the palace, flying towards the city center.

"Did everyone see that? The new ruler doesn't value us slaves either, and he's wantonly killing our comrades. The soldiers in front of us are accomplices. Charge with me!"
